Overview
Interface is seeking an experienced Security Alarm Technician. In this position, you will diagnose and resolve application issues while maintaining, Fire Alarm, TCP/IP Networks, Video Surveillance, Access Control & Wireless solutions. As a Security Alarm Technician, you will be responsible for installing and servicing, , security and video surveillance systems, wireless devices, and cabling. This will also include installing various electronic components and cables including terminating, commissioning and testing.

Responsibilities
• Install, repair and maintain Intrusion, Fire, Video Surveillance, Network and VoIP integrated systems.
• Work in the field with the most efficient methods to solve service issues.
• Train customers on Interface provided systems.
• Maintain acceptable and accurate inventory levels by conducting physical inventory counts.
• Verify and submit all documentation for inventoried items according to company policy.
• Install and terminate network and security cabling.
• Firestopping various types of cable penetrations.
• Understand, adhere to, and promote OSHA Health & Safety policies
• Interface with customer contacts on projects and service requests.
• Interface with the end-user and coordinate with vendors for each project.
• Hands-on field interaction with customers at the site level.
• Maintain assigned vehicle and tools.
• The position is full-time and may include rotating on-call duties
Qualifications
• High School Diploma or GED; Vocational/Technical/Business School, strongly preferred.
• Valid driver's license.
• NICET Certification is a plus.
• Verifiable field experience.
• Ability to read and understand technical documents and drawings.
• Solid comprehension of the terminology about the installation and service of telecom, data, security, and wireless systems.
• Solid Comprehension of the publications about standard telecom, data, security, and wireless systems practices, engineering, and Federal, State, and local safety standards.
• Computer proficiency including Microsoft Office Suite.
• Ability to pass applicable state and federal background checks to become a registered security installer.
• Comfortable using small hand tools and power tools.
• Legally authorized to work in the United States of America.
• Ability to work outdoors in all weather conditions.
• Schedule flexibility and willingness to travel overnight
• Physical demands include:
• Finger and wrist dexterity and hand/eye coordination.
• Heavy physical effort.
• Climbing stairs, ladders, and/or scaffolds.
• Ability to work from heights such as man lifts, scissor lifts, and rooftops utilizing proper fall protection.
• Carrying loads up and downstairs.
• Ability to work outdoors in all weather conditions.
• Schedule flexibility and willingness to travel overnight
Field Technicians - Minimum 2 years of experience as a proven Field Technician in the electronic security industry
